In Germany, buying a parrot involves adhering to particular legal requirements. It's crucial to consider the following:

CITES Regulations: Many parrot types are safeguarded under the Convention on International Trade in Endangered Species (CITES). Ensure that the seller offers a CITES certificate for any types that falls under this policy.

Origin and Welfare: Germany has rigorous animal welfare laws. Constantly purchase from reputable breeders or certified animal shops that comply with the regulations worrying pet well-being.

Microchipping: Certain types need microchipping. Acquaint yourself with the requirements particular to the types you want to buy.

Before bringing a parrot home, it's necessary to make the necessary preparations. Here's a list of essentials you will need:

Cage: A spacious cage that enables movement and play. Guarantee that the bars are properly spaced for the parrot types you choose.

Perches: Provide various perches of various widths and products to promote foot health.

Toys: Stimulating toys are needed for mental health. Try to find chewable, durable toys.

Food and Water Dishes: Use stainless steel or ceramic meals that are easy to tidy.

Quality Food: Invest in top quality pellets or seeds specially formulated for your selected species.

Bedding: Use appropriate bed linen product (e.g., paper or paper towels) to line the bottom of the cage.
Taking care of Your Parrot
As soon as you've invited a parrot into your home, understanding its care is vital. Here are some standard care ideas:

Socializing: Spend time daily with your parrot to construct trust and friendship. Parrots are social creatures that prosper on interaction.

Workout: Allow time outside the cage in a safe environment for physical and mental stimulation.

Routine Check-ups: Schedule periodic veterinarian visits to monitor your parrot's health.

Grooming: Regularly check and trim nails and provide opportunities for bathing.
Frequently asked questions
1. What is the typical life expectancy of a parrot?Parrots typically have long life-spans, differing by types. Smaller species like budgerigars might live in between 5-10 years, while bigger types like African Grey parrots can live up to 60 years or more.

2. Can I train my parrot to talk?Yes, particularly species like the African Grey and Amazon parrots. Constant interaction and positive support can help in teaching them different words and expressions.

3. Is it better to buy a single parrot or a pair?It depends upon the owner's accessibility for social interaction. However, managing 2 parrots can be more demanding.

4. What should I do if my parrot stops eating?Speak with a veterinarian immediately. Modifications in eating routines can indicate health concerns. Offering a range of food choices may likewise assist stimulate their cravings.

5. Are there any noise limitations for parrots in homes?Yes, some municipalities have sound policies. It's smart to check regional laws and think about the noise level of the types you're interested in, as lots of parrots can be loud.
